Kinds of Fireplaces

When thinking about a fireplace, it’s vital to recognize the numerous alternatives readily available. Each type has its own benefits, drawbacks, and specific considerations.

Type Description Pros Cons
Wood Burning Traditional units that burn firewood. Authentic experience and warmth. Requires continuous attention and upkeep.
Gas Uses natural gas or lp to produce a flame. Easy to use and low upkeep. Minimal visual compared to wood fires.
Electric Uses electrical power to produce heat and flame effects. Safe and doesn’t produce real flames. Less authentic atmosphere; greater electricity costs.
Ethanol Burns bio-ethanol fuel without any chimney required. Environment-friendly and versatile. Minimal heating capability; greater fuel expenses.
Pellet Stove Uses compressed wood or biomass pellets for fuel. Effective and clean-burning. Needs electrical power and unique venting.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the very best kind of fireplace for heating a large space?

Gas or wood-burning fireplaces are usually more reliable for heating large areas. Gas models tend to disperse heat more equally, making them ideal for larger locations.

2. Just how much should I expect to pay for a brand-new fireplace?

Rates can differ widely based upon the type of fireplace, setup costs, and extra features. Fundamental designs can begin around ₤ 500, while more sophisticated installations can surpass ₤ 5,000 or more.

3. Do I need to hire an expert for installation?

For a lot of kinds of fireplaces, particularly gas and wood-burning models, expert setup is recommended to guarantee security and compliance with regional codes.

4. How typically should I clean up and maintain my fireplace?

Wood-burning fireplaces generally need cleaning before each season, while gas models can be serviced yearly. Constantly seek advice from the maker’s standards for specifics.

5. Are electric fireplaces effective for heating?

Electric fireplaces can be efficient, particularly for small to medium-sized spaces. However, they might not provide the exact same level of heat as traditional wood or gas choices.
